1.7.2 Locking the Power Breaker with the Padlock
When the machine is not used for a long period of time, lock the power
breaker using the padlock.
(1) Pull out the lock lever of the power breaker in the A direction. See
the figure below.
Keep holding the lock lever. Otherwise, the lever will pull back.
(2) Engage the shackle of the padlock through the lock slots and lock
the crank.
Fig. 1C26
CAUTION
Keep the padlock key inaccessible to any person ex-
cept for the person in charge of maintenance.

2. "PASS" Mode
When the machine is set in the "PASS" mode, it just carries the P.C.B.
(input conveyor P.C.B. positioning section output conveyor) to the
output conveyor without placing any components on the P.C.B.
When the machine must transfer P.C.B.’s to the output machine with-
out placing any components, follow the steps below.
2.1 Start of "PASS" Operation
(1) Ensure the safety around the front safety door and the feeder car-
riage sections.
(2) Set the [OPERATION] switch on the front operation panel to "RUN".
Be sure to remove the key from the machine.
Fig. 1C27
(3) Check the surroundings of the machine and confirm safety before
starting the "PASS" operation.
CAUTION
Check carefully that there is no person around the
moving mechanisms of the machine. (Especially, the
other side of machine operation).
Make sure that no objects (tools, parts, etc.) remain
within the moving mechanisms of the machine.

(4) Press the [OPN. MODE] button on the submenu bar to open the
"OPN. MODE" submenu window. After that, press the [PASS] but-
ton entitled "RUN MODE" in the "Run Mode" tab sheet.
Fig. 1C28
(5) Perform the zeroing operation in the "Origin/Signal Info." tab sheet
of the "AUTO OPN." submenu window.
